MAPACA 2025 Summer Virtual Symposium Call for Proposals
Proposals are welcome on all aspects of popular and American culture for inclusion in the 2025 Mid-Atlantic Popular & American Culture Association (MAPACA) Virtual Symposium, to be held on July 20, 2025. Single papers, panels, roundtables, and alternative formats are welcome. The online event is open internationally and we especially invite anyone unable to attend our in-person conference in November. Presenters are welcome to submit separate proposals for both this Summer Virtual Symposium and our in-person conference in November.
Proposals should take the form of 300-word abstracts and may only be submitted to one appropriate area. For a list of areas and area chair contact information, visit our Areas Page. General questions can be directed to mapaca@mapaca.net. The deadline for submission is May 31, 2025.
MAPACA’s participants are college and university faculty, independent scholars and artists, and graduate and undergraduate students. MAPACA is an inclusive professional organization dedicated to the study of popular and American culture in all their multidisciplinary manifestations. It is a regional division of the Popular Culture and American Culture Association, which, in the words of Popular Culture Association founder Ray Browne, is a “multi-disciplinary association interested in new approaches to the expressions, mass media and all other phenomena of everyday life.”
